How to Host Local Events That Promote Your Home Services Business
Hosting local events is an effective way to promote your home services business while engaging your community. These events provide a platform to showcase your services, build brand awareness, and foster relationships with potential clients. First, determine the objectives of your event. Are you looking to attract new customers, generate leads, or establish partnerships? Knowing your goals will help shape the nature of the event you’ll host. Next, consider the type of event you’d like to organize. Options can range from workshops and seminars to community fairs or open houses. Choose something that aligns with your services. For instance, if you provide landscaping services, a gardening workshop could attract potential clients. Be sure to plan every detail, including choosing a date and venue, promoting the event, and recruiting staff to help. Utilize local channels such as social media, community boards, and email newsletters to spread the word. Engaging local influencers can also enhance visibility. Finally, during the event, be prepared with promotional materials, special offers, and follow-up strategies to convert attendees into clients.
Planning the Perfect Local Event
When planning your local event, attention to detail can make a significant difference in its success. Begin by establishing a budget that covers all necessary costs, including venue rental, promotional materials, refreshments, and staffing. Identify potential venues that suit your event’s theme and accommodate your expected audience. If you’re hosting a workshop, consider local community centers, while open houses might work best at your business location. Ensure the venue has the necessary facilities, such as parking and accessibility. Creating a timeline is also essential. Start your planning process weeks or even months in advance to allow for flexibility and adjustments. Determine critical milestones, including securing the venue, finalizing the agenda, and confirming speakers or presenters. As you finalize details, develop a comprehensive marketing strategy. Utilize social media platforms like Facebook and Instagram, where you can reach your audience effectively. Craft engaging posts that highlight what your event offers. Create shareable graphics to encourage attendees to spread the word among their networks. This strategy can significantly boost attendance and engagement.
During the event itself, creating an inviting atmosphere is crucial for engaging attendees and promoting your services. Use banners, signage, and branded materials to enhance visibility and ensure your business stands out. Schedule demonstrations or interactive activities related to your home services to showcase your skills and expertise. For instance, a home renovation event could feature live demonstrations of your services in action. Consider offering exclusive event-only promotions or discounts to encourage attendees to book your services on the spot. You can also utilize contests or giveaways as a fun way to draw in potential clients. Encourage guests to provide their contact information for your mailing list in exchange for a chance to win prizes, further strengthening your lead generation efforts. Once the event concludes, the work doesn’t stop. Following up with attendees is vital for building relationships. Send thank-you emails, along with any resources or follow-up information promised during the event. This gesture not only shows appreciation but also keeps your business top of mind for those who attended.
Measuring the Success of Your Event
After hosting your local event, it’s essential to measure its success. Tracking performance metrics can inform your future planning and highlight areas for improvement. Start by evaluating attendance numbers. Did you meet your target goals, or did you fall short? Gather feedback from attendees through surveys, either immediately after the event or via follow-up emails. Ask specific questions regarding their experiences, what they liked, and how your event could improve. Also, assess engagement during the event. Was there interest in your services? Did attendees participate in demonstrations or ask questions? Another critical performance indicator is conversion rates. How many attendees became leads or booked your services after the event? Tracking this metric will help you understand the ROI of your efforts. Use this data to refine your strategies for future events. Even if attendance was lower than expected but quality leads resulted, it’s a success. Finally, don’t forget to celebrate your achievements. Recognizing those involved in planning and executing the event fosters a positive atmosphere and encourages continued creativity.
